The AI revolution in chemistry operates on three levels. To begin with, there's the "AI Assistant" – glorified automation that handles boring stuff like documentation and patent searches. Then comes the "AI Analyst," which crunches data and slashes R&D timelines. But the real game-changer? The "AI Researcher" – systems that autonomously design new molecules and materials. Not just helping scientists – sometimes replacing them.

Chemistry's AI evolution: from digital assistants to autonomous researchers that don't just support science—they might eventually replace scientists.

These aren't your grandma's algorithms. Graph Neural Networks treat molecules like tiny social networks, with atoms as nodes and bonds as edges. AlphaFold shocked everyone by solving protein folding problems that stumped researchers for decades. Machine learning now predicts properties, synthesis routes, and molecular behavior faster than you can say "periodic table." However, many AI tools struggle with reproducibility issues, generating different results when running the same task repeatedly.

ChemXploreML represents this new breed of tools. It's offline (protecting your precious data), user-friendly (no PhD in computer science required), and predicts everything from melting points to molecular features in seconds. The impact is everywhere. Biochemistry, materials science, pharmaceutical research – all transformed. This transformation represents the emergence of technology-as-participant where AI becomes a collaborative partner rather than just a tool. AI identifies synthesis routes, predicts protein functions, and designs materials with specific properties. Tasks that once took months now happen overnight. These advanced systems can now process multimodal AI inputs including text, images, and complex molecular data simultaneously.

Of course, implementation isn't magic. It requires infrastructure, training, and reliable tech support. Scientists need interdisciplinary skills to bridge chemistry and computation. But the payoff is enormous: faster revelations, lower costs, and breakthroughs in materials that were previously unimaginable.
